Wireless Sensor Network (WSN) is an emerging technology, which enables new innovative trends and equipments to resolve the issues of current and future world. The WSN is a combination of tiny sensor nodes equipped with a minimal battery power, mini processor and a RAM. The battery is non-rechargeable in nature and thus the need for energy efficiency becomes a vital task for WSN. This paper deals with improving the energy efficiency through Energy Proficient AODV protocol (EP-AODV). The proposed work utilizes minimal energy, power amplification and efficient routing technique to improve lifetime of the network. Comparison of EP-AODV with other existing schemes, EP-AODV achieves better throughput, energy efficient, First-Nod-Dies ratio and so on. Thus, the proposed EP-AODV protocol achieves better energy efficient protocol for WSN.
